How it works

From your vendors' signals to an explainable verdict.

unilinx.ai sits on top of the vendors you already trust β€” no new SDK, no duplicate data collection. Three stages, one continuously-learning intelligence layer, fully explainable end-to-end.

01

Connect

Plug in the feeds you already receive from your device-intelligence, behavioral-biometrics, network, telco and EDR vendors. No unilinx SDK, no duplicate collection β€” just your data, normalized.

02

Correlate

A live intelligence graph links identities, devices, IPs and behaviors across sessions β€” surfacing shared fingerprints and suspicious clusters your vendors couldn't see in isolation.

03

Decide

Every risk score ships with the contributing vendor signals, a confidence band, and a timeline your analysts can defend in audit.

Use cases

One platform. Every fraud & intrusion surface.

Deploy once and cover the attack patterns that cost your team the most.

Cross-vendor fraud rings

When shared devices, payment methods and behavioral tells surface across vendors that can't see each other, unilinx stitches them together and reveals the ring.

Fewer alerts, better alerts

A vendor fires a high-risk signal, but three others on the same session look clean. Our AI uses the full picture to suppress the noise β€” fewer false positives, fewer analyst wake-ups.

Mule & money-laundering networks

Mule rings and laundering flows only appear when you see fund movement across users, devices and channels together. unilinx correlates that flow across your vendors and flags the whole network, not a single leg.

Account takeover

Correlating behavioral drift with device and network signals across vendors lets our AI catch ATO the moment a session turns hostile β€” without the single-signal false alarms.

Signals we provide

We don't just correlate the signals. We can deliver them.

unilinx.ai is SDK-free by design β€” we correlate the feeds you already have. But when a feed is missing, our partner betterbehave generates it for you: behavioural biometrics and device intelligence through a lightweight SDK that stays invisible to your users, and network intelligence server-side. Same graph, same explainable decision.

SDK Β· via betterbehave

Behavioural biometrics

Keystroke dynamics, pointer rhythm, scroll cadence and gesture physics β€” a continuous, passive behavioural fingerprint that flags the instant a session stops behaving like its owner.

Keystroke Β· Pointer Β· Scroll Β· Gesture
SDK Β· via betterbehave

Device signals

200+ device attributes β€” OS, GPU, fonts, codecs, sensors and browser entropy β€” with headless, emulator and spoofing detection. Recognise the real device; unmask the fake.

Fingerprint Β· Headless Β· Emulator Β· Spoof
No SDK Β· server-side

Network signals

VPN, proxy and TOR classification, datacenter-ASN detection, impossible-travel and velocity β€” the transport-layer tells that expose automation hiding in plain sight.

VPN / Proxy / TOR Β· ASN Β· Impossible travel
